Kelly is seeking an experienced and motivated RPO Recruiter to support talent acquisition efforts for our clients. In this role, you will manage the full recruitment lifecycle, partnering closely with hiring managers to attract, assess, and hire top talent across a variety of positions. The ideal candidate is customer-focused, organized, and experienced in high-volume recruiting environments.
Key Responsibilities- Manage the full-cycle recruiting process from sourcing through offer acceptance.
- Partner with hiring managers to understand hiring needs and develop recruitment strategies.
- Source, screen, interview, and evaluate candidates for a variety of positions.
- Build and maintain talent pipelines through proactive sourcing and networking.
- Utilize applicant tracking systems (ATS) and recruiting tools to manage candidate activity.
- Ensure a positive candidate experience throughout the recruitment process.
- Meet established recruitment metrics and hiring goals.
- Maintain compliance with company policies and employment regulations.
- Provide regular updates to stakeholders regarding recruiting activity and market trends.
